Heber's Story
Birth: May 8th, 1858 | male | in Hoe, Norfolk, England
Death: August 25th, 1862 | 4 years old | in Chimney Rock, Morrill, Nebraska
Memorial: Stone 11 | right column
Heber Jones is the son of Jeremiah Jones and Mary Wilson, both from England. After immigrating to America, the family joined the Joseph Horne Company to journey to the Great Salt Lake Valley with other members of The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-day Saints.
Exhaustive travel conditions, disease, injury, lack of food and medicine, prematurity, and extreme weather were some of the greatest threats to pioneers. While the company was camped near Chimney Rock, 4-year-old Heber passed away of unknown causes. He is buried there on Sunday, August 25, 1862.
